What To Do This Weekend In The Hudson Valley Mar 19 – Mar 21
✨The weekend is here and things are warming up! Get out and have some fun with all that the Hudson Valley has to offer
✨The weekend is here and things are warming up! Get out and have some fun with all that the Hudson Valley has to offer